How to create an E-commerce Website

how to create an ecommerce website

If you’re looking for a way to start an e-commerce business, but don’t know where to begin, this post is for you. Read about the steps to follow in order to create the perfect e-commerce website, plus tips on how to get your brand recognized by customers and compete with other brands.

What is e-commerce website?

An E-commerce website enables you to sell goods or services to customers over the internet. It is designed to provide your customers with an experience that will lead them to make a purchase. Once a customer finds and buys your goods or services, they move to the checkout phase, where they provide payment and shipping information. The ecommerce website then passes this information to a payment processor, who validates the transaction and collects the funds. Once the funds have been received, the seller ships the order or sends the digital product by email.

E-commerce websites come in all shapes and sizes, from small niche stores to large multi-national retailers. No matter what type of business you have, if you want to sell products or services online, an e-commerce website is the way to do it. Creating an e-commerce website is not as difficult or expensive as you might think. Check out our page for to learn how much does it cost to a build a complete website. With the right platform and some basic technical knowledge, you can have your own e-commerce website up and running in no time. In this article, we will show you how to create an e-commerce business website in easy steps.

Steps to create an E-commerce website

Step 1: Market Research

The first step to creating a successful e-commerce business website is to research your product. You need to make sure that there is a demand for your product and that you are able to source it at a reasonable price. There are many ways to research products, but the most important thing is to talk to potential customers and get their feedback. Once you have a good understanding of your product, you can move on to the next step. After you decide on the products, it is important to organize your website and categorize your products and determine the purpose of your ecommerce website.

Step 2: Pick a Domain Name

The domain name can be anything you want, but it’s best to choose something that’s short, easy to remember, and relevant to your business. It can be your business’s name or combination of words that will give an idea of what you are selling. This way, it will make it easier for the visitors to remember you.

Once you have a domain name in mind, the next step is to check if it’s available. You can do this by doing a simple search on Google or using a domain name checker tool.

If the domain name you want is available, the next step is to register it. You can do this through a domain registrar like GoDaddy or Hostinger. Once you’ve registered your domain name, you’re ready to move on to the next step!

Step 3: Select a CMS – Platform

There are two main ways to create an ecommerce website: using an all-in-one platform like Shopify, or building a custom site with WordPress.  All of these CMS platforms have their own advantages and disadvantages, so it’s important to select the one that is best suited for your specific needs.

  • WordPress is a popular choice for e-commerce websites because it is relatively easy to use and has a large selection of plugins and themes available. Building a custom WordPress site requires some technical skills, but it’s still possible to create a professional website without being a developer. If you get stuck, there are plenty of resources available to help you. However, WordPress can be somewhat limited in terms of scalability and customization.
  • WooCommerce is a WordPress plugin that turns your site into an online store. It includes features for managing inventory, processing payments, shipping orders, and more. You can also find additional plugins to add extra functionality to your store, such as discounts and customer reviews.
  • Shopify is another popular option for e-commerce websites. It is a hosted platform, which means that you don’t need to worry about hosting fees or server maintenance. It’s a complete platform that takes care of all the technical aspects of running an online store, so you can focus on selling your products. You don’t need any previous experience with web design or development, and there’s no software to install or maintain. Shopify also has built-in features for managing inventory, processing payments, shipping orders, and more. However, it can be more expensive than some of the other options available.
  • Magento is a powerful eCommerce platform that offers a lot of flexibility and customization options. However, it can be more difficult to use than some of the other CMS platforms and may require more technical expertise.

Step 4: Design Your Storefront

Assuming you’re using WordPress, there are a few different ways to approach this. If you want to get really fancy, you can hire a web designer to help you create a custom theme for your site. But if you’re on a budget, or if you’d prefer to DIY, there are plenty of great themes available for free or for purchase that will help you create a professional-looking storefront.

When choosing the design of the website, it’s important to consider the overall design and layout of your site. You want visitors to be able to easily navigate your store and find the products they’re looking for.

Step 5: Pick Payment Options and Shipping Methods

The next step is to pick payment options and shipping methods for your eCommerce website. There are several different ways to accept payments on your website. The most popular option is to use a third-party payment processor such as PayPal or Stripe. These services will handle all of the financial transactions for you, so you don’t have to worry about setting up a merchant account or dealing with sensitive credit card information.

Another option is to use a shopping cart system that includes built-in payment processing. These can be more expensive than using a third-party processor, but they often offer more features and flexibility.

Once you’ve decided how you’re going to accept payments, you need to choose a shipping method. If you’re selling physical goods, you’ll need to decide whether to ship them yourself or use a fulfillment service. Fulfillment services will pick, pack, and ship your orders for you, which can save you a lot of time and hassle. However, they often charge higher fees than if you were to ship the orders yourself.

If you’re selling digital products (such as ebooks or software), you can deliver them electronically without having to worry about shipping costs. Just make sure your delivery system is secure and able to handle large

Unique Features of E-Commerce Websites

There are several unique features that distinguish an e-commerce website from other types of websites. Here are some of the most important ones:

  • Product Catalog: Typically have a large product catalogue that includes a variety of products and services.
  • Shopping Cart: Provide a shopping cart functionality that allows users to select and save products they wish to purchase.
  • Payment Gateway: Integrate payment gateways to facilitate online payment transactions.
  • Order Management: Gives an order management system to manage and track orders.
  • User Account: Enable user accounts that allow customers to store their personal information, shipping addresses, and order history.
  • Search Functionality: Offer a search functionality that allows customers to easily find the products they are looking for.
  • Product Reviews and Ratings: Allow customers to leave reviews and ratings for products they have purchased.
  • Security: Implement security measures to protect customers’ personal and payment information.
  • Mobile Optimization: Often optimized for mobile devices, allowing customers to shop on-the-go.
  • Personalization: Can personalize the shopping experience for customers by suggesting products based on their browsing and purchase history.

Advantages of ecommerce websites

  • Ecommerce websites allow consumers to shop online in a variety of ways. With online shopping, consumers are able to compare prices between different products. This gives consumers a better idea of the products they are purchasing, and it also forces businesses to compete on price. This, in turn, decreases profit margins and lowers the quality of products.
  • Can connect with customers from all over the world.
  • eCommerce websites can be available 24 hours a day. Online retailers can reach millions of potential consumers.
  • In addition, ecommerce websites can increase the size of their customer bases, which increases their sales and profits.
  • Another major benefit of ecommerce websites is their ability to automate processes and procedures. Manual record keeping is very inefficient, and ecommerce websites make the entire process easy. Automated software can even handle shipping, which saves both time and money.
  • Additionally, unique business promotions can draw new customers and keep old ones for longer.
  • This type of website can also help you create a brand identity.

What can be the issues of ecommerce websites

E-commerce websites are not without their challenges and issues. Here are some common ones:

  • Technical issues: Can experience technical issues such as site downtime, slow loading times, and bugs that can negatively impact the user experience.
  • Security breaches: E-commerce websites are prime targets for hackers who try to gain access to customer data such as credit card information. If security measures are not in place, these breaches can be devastating for both customers and the website owner.
  • Fraud: Can be vulnerable to fraud, such as chargebacks, counterfeit products, and fake customer reviews.
  • Customer service issues: Customer satisfaction is very important, and if customer service is not up to par, customers may take their business elsewhere.
  • Shipping and logistics: Rely on reliable and efficient shipping and logistics to ensure that products are delivered to customers in a timely and cost-effective manner. However, shipping and logistics can be complex and difficult to manage, leading to delays and other issues.
  • Competition: E-commerce is a highly competitive industry, and new websites are constantly emerging. Established e-commerce websites must constantly innovate and improve to stay ahead of the competition.
  • Legal issues: Must comply with various laws and regulations related to online commerce, such as data privacy laws and consumer protection laws. Failure to comply with these laws can result in legal consequences and damage to the website’s reputation.


Creating an e-commerce website doesn’t have to be difficult or time-consuming. With the right platform and a little bit of effort, you can have your own e-commerce site up and running in no time. We hope our five easy steps have given you the confidence you need to get started on your own e-commerce journey. If you have any questions or comments, please feel free to contact. We wish you all the best in your future endeavours!